Learning Support Assistant (SEN)

A friendly and diverse Secondary School in Barking and Dagenham is searching for a Learning Support Assistant (SEN) to join their friendly, supportive, and successful team. This role will involve supporting pupils across KS3, KS4 and KS5 with students requiring additional support due to various SEND/SEMH needs.

The ideal candidate for the Learning Support Assistant (SEN) role would be Psychology graduates wanting to pursue a career in Education, Therapy, Psychological Research, Mental Health, Speech, and Language and many more! You'll be working alongside a dedicated inclusion team, teachers and SLT as well as having the opportunity to engage with specialists regularly.

About the Learning Support Assistant (SEN) Role

  • Provide support to pupils with SEND and/or Social Inclusion needs.
  • To work alongside a supportive, friendly, and determined inclusion staff.
  • To facilitate the differentiation of tasks for students.
  • To work with small groups or individual students on specific tasks.

Learning Support Assistant (SEN) Person Specification

  • An outgoing graduate ready for the next stage of their career.
  • Hardworking, committed, and excited to help all pupils flourish.
  • Flexible, open-minded, and strong communication skills.
  • Genuine passion for working in education.
  • Experience or awareness of young people with possible barriers to learning.
